Field Carrier Landing Practices at NALF Fentress Naval Auxiliary Landing Facility Fentress Chesapeake, Virginia Thursday April 5, 2018 This video covers a small chunk of FCLPs at NALF Fentress in the later part of the afternoon. This was my first ever visit to Fentress, and while I knew you had to get an invite to be able to photograph and film near the LSO shack, I knew it was possible to observe operations from the other side of the runway. Aircraft seen here include F/A-18F Super Hornets from VFA-11 “Red Rippers“ and VFA-211 “Fighting Checkmates“. These pilots practice FCLPs to hone their skills prior to actually landing a Super Hornet on the deck of an aircraft carrier. You’ll also hear the pilots communicate with the Landing Signal Officer known as “Paddles“ as he helps to guide in each aircraft.
